【企画】 AIが何もかも決める脱出ゲーム
はじめに
こんにちは、助六です!
最近、Unityを使ったゲーム開発にAIの機能を取り入れることを始めました。
音声認識、画像認識をUIに、LLM、画像生成などの生成AI要素も盛り込んだゲーム開発をバンバン発信していこうと思います!
今回は、「AIが何もかも決める脱出ゲーム」の企画についてご紹介します。
ゲームの企画
従来の脱出ゲームは、特定のシチュエーションに基づいて進行しますが、私の新しいゲームでは、そのシチュエーションをAIが生成します。
具体的には、LLMが毎回異なるシチュエーションを考え出し、そのシチュエーションに合わせた背景画像をAIで生成します。
これにより、プレイヤーは毎回新鮮な体験を楽しむことができます。
また、脱出方法も一風変わっています。
プレイヤーが画像を送信し、AIがその画像に写るものを認識します。
その後、LLMがその物を使って現在のシチュエーションから脱出できるかどうかを判断します。
これにより、脱出方法も毎回変わるため、ゲームはよりエキサイティングで多様性に富んだものになります。
使用技術
LLM(大規模言語モデル):OpenAIのChatGPTのAPIを使用して、シチュエーションの生成と脱出方法の判定を行います。
画像生成:OpenAIのDall-eのAPIを使用して、シチュエーションに合った背景画像を生成します。
画像認識:OpenAIのVisionAPIを使用して、プレイヤーが送信した画像に写る物を認識します。
最後に
今後のブログでは、開発の過程での技術的な発見や課題、
そして完成時の発表をお届けする予定です。
AIがどのようにゲーム開発に革命をもたらすのか、ぜひ楽しみにしていてください。コメントやフィードバックもお待ちしています!
Xで情報発信も始めました!「AI×ゲーム開発」にご興味ある方はフォローしていただけると嬉しいです!